kõikumav
Kõikumav is an Estonian adjective meaning oscillating, fluctuating, or wobbling. It describes objects, states, or processes that vary over time between different values or conditions, sometimes with regularly repeating patterns and other times with irregular fluctuations.
Etymology: Derived from the noun kõikumine (fluctuation, wobble) with the participial suffix -av, forming an adjective
